Purpose and function in the suspension
The front axle stabilizer in the BMW F01 LCI acts as a connecting element between the left and right sides of the suspension, reducing the difference in wheel deflection when cornering. Properly selected lateral stiffness contributes to:
- reduced body roll during dynamic driving,
- more neutral handling characteristics,
- better tire contact with the road surface during rapid changes of direction.
As a result, the driver receives clearer feedback from the front axle, and the car remains stable both at higher highway speeds and in tight bends.

Service application and benefits of replacement
Replacing the front axle stabilizer is recommended, among other things, when there is noticeable "wandering" of the front end, excessive body roll, or after collisions and mechanical damage to the suspension. Using an original bar allows you to:
- restore the factory driving properties of the BMW F01 LCI,
- minimize the risk of incorrect suspension geometry alignment,
- maintain the consistent operation of assistance systems (including traction and stability control).
For the full effect, it is worth verifying the condition of the stabilizer links, bushings, and other front suspension components in parallel.
